Job Title: Desktop support level 1/2Location: Stonehouse, Gloucestershire Start Date: 5th May 2025Duration: 3 year contract Rate: £130-140 DOE per day via umbrella as role is inside IR35

Key Responsibilities:•    Provide technical support and troubleshooting for end-user devices, including hardware and software issues.•    Manage and support Windows 10/11 environments and related software and applications.•    Support and troubleshoot mobile devices, particularly BlackBerry and iPhones.•    Build, configure, replace, and troubleshoot EUC (End User Computing) hardware components.•    Perform data backup and recovery tasks.•    Work within virtual, MDM (Mobile Device Management), and VPN environments.•    Maintain accurate records of work performed and ensure clear, effective communication with end users.•    Adhere to ITIL processes and work within an ITIL environment.

Skillset required•    Task support, incident support•    Servicenow updates•    Good general understanding of IT principles such as Networks, Hardware and Domains•    Working knowledge of leading software packages such as MS Office and Lotus Notes•    Good working knowledge of Windows 10/11 and related software and applications•    Good experience in End User device hardware and software troubleshooting•    Knowledge of mobile devices, in particular Blackberry and iPhones•    Experience with building, configuring, replacing and troubleshooting EUC hardware components•    Good Experience in Data Backup Techniques•    Familiarity with virtual , MDM and VPN environments•    Familiarity with Microsoft SCCM would be advantageous•    CompTIA A+, MCP/MCSE are desirable certifications•    DELL Certification desirable•    Knowledge of ITIL and experience of working within an ITIL environment would be beneficial•    Exceptional customer facing skills•    Able to communicate clearly and effectively with end users•    Logical and analytical approach to work•    Accurate record keeping•    Able to work unsupervised•    Good timekeeper•    Intense focus on quality work•    Productive and Efficient
